Students of Second Year Engineering participate in Google’s prestigious Team Programming Competition - HASHCODE

Students of Second Year Computer Science & Engineering viz. Mayur, Manjukrishna, Swasthik, Suhan, Prathiksha, Neha, Nihal, Vinisha, Shreevishnu, Akhilesh and Rovit, participated in ‘HASHCODE’, a team programming competition, organized by Google, for students and professionals around the world.
Various teams were formed and an engineering problem was given to solve. Team comprising of Prathiksha, Neha and Rovit secured 10th place in Manipal Hub, 1723th place all over India and 8034th place around the globe.
Hashcode is Google’s team-based programming competition. It allows sharing of skills and connect with other coders while working together to solve a problem modeled off a real Google engineering challenge.
In small teams of two to four, coders all over the world will tackle the first problem through an Online Qualification Round.
